LAPS NEWS RELEASE
Los Alamos Public Schools has announced that for the third consecutive year, there were no findings in the audit.
Cordova CPAs LLC presented their findings to the School Board during the February 13 meeting, noting that the audit was conducted in accordance with Generally Accepted Auditing Standards (GAAS) and Generally Accepted Government Auditing Standards (GAGAS). There were no findings on financial reporting, compliance and other matters. Likewise, there were no findings in the report on compliance for each major program and on internal control over compliance required by the uniform guidance.
“The entire finance team was fantastic to work with and we appreciate their hard work during the last five months,” Robert Cordova said.
The School Board recognized members of the LAPS Business Department on this achievement during the board meeting.
